What companies run services between Pisa, Italy and Pompei, Campania, Italy?

You can take a train from Pisa Centrale to Pompei via Roma Termini and Napoli Centrale in around 4h 57m.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Pisa to Napoli P.zza Garibaldi 3 times a day. Tickets cost €45–80 and the journey takes 8h 15m.
